NCEA exams begin on Tuesday 5th November this year. To further help students prepare for these a study timetable has been shared with students. If students wish to come to these workshops then they need to let the teacher involved know, sign in at the office when they arrive and sign out when they leave.
Students need to bring their exam slip to every exam. If they have misplaced this, then they need to contact Ms McLaughlin as soon as possible to get a new one. All details of the times and dates of their exams are on this slip. The timetable for the exams can be found here:
https://www2.nzqa.govt.nz/ncea/exam-timetable-and-key-assessment-dates/exam-timetable/.
If a student cannot sit an exam for a justified reason, they can apply for a derived grade. These are based on the grade they received when sitting a practice assessment earlier this year. Please get in touch as soon as possible if your child may need to go through this process.
Students need to wear their school uniform for any study workshops and for the exams. School lunches will not be provided to seniors during this time.
